Transaction 73e33121dbeffc6bee2cc21337661ab005d4d7f32e438ccf2008700b29a11331
1 Input
1 Output
-
73e33121dbeffc6bee2cc21337661ab005d4d7f32e438ccf2008700b29a11331:0
- value
- 29089291
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b6a7b951652b5052ed3d19e5670126b8dea77df OP_EQUALVERIFY OP_CHECKSIG
- address
- 19LN41RZdeGUCyLDneWFtoxSWzVrp35Pey